2

Prepros 具有有用的功能:

//@prepros-prepend filename.js

其中包括当前文件开头的js 文件,但我需要jquery document.ready 语句中包含文件,如下所示:

$(function(){
  //@prepros-include code1.js
  //@prepros-include code2.js
  //@prepros-include code3.js
  //@prepros-include code3.js
  ...
});

这是否可能,或者您有任何其他解决方案如何连接许多将绑定在 jquery$(function(){...});包装器内的 js 片段?

[编辑] 附言。我不想写$(function(){...});在每个部分文件中。

4

1 回答 1

1

好吧,如果你使用谷歌,第一个链接将是这个jquery 主页 但是如果你想在你的 js 文件中包含其他 js 文件,请使用这个。

$.getScript( "ajax/test.js" )
  .done(function( script, textStatus ) {
    console.log( textStatus );
  })
  .fail(function( jqxhr, settings, exception ) {
    alert("No file found");
});

当然你可以很容易地像这样轻松地画一条线。

$.getScript( "ajax/test.js" );
于 2015-11-16T10:58:28.170 回答